Calling all Senior Nursing Students Nurse Graduates and new RNs it is time to apply for our Emergency Department Nurse Residency Program startingFall 2026!

The ChristianaCare Nurse Residency Program is accredited with distinction as a Practice Transition Program by the American Nurses Credentialing Centers Commission on Accreditation in Practice Transition Programs.

Research validates that new to practice nurses completing a structured and accredited residency program leads to:

  • increase in competency
  • reduction of error
  • reduced self-reported stress
  • increased job satisfaction

Therefore we are committed to supporting all registered nurses with under one year of experience through a nurse residency specialty track.

This exciting curriculum integrates:

  • Lecture and simulation education
  • Peer support
  • Preceptor-led clinical experiences structured to foster critical thinking evidence-based practice interdisciplinary collaboration effective communication quality and safety and professional development.

This unique 26-week program is a combination of classroom and clinical experiences. Participants will work under the supervision of experienced emergency nurses for the length of the program. Upon program completion the participant will be hired as a staff member in one of our 3 Emergency Departments within ChristianaCare. This program has been devised by the nurses in the Emergency Department at Christiana Hospital. This program allows for a smooth transition from GN to the ED staff RN role into ED nursing for those candidates qualified. The 26-week preceptor led program will be followed by continued residency meetings during months 8 10 and 12 to further develop as professional nurses and integral members of our caregiver team.



ChristianaCare has 3 Emergency Departments:

  • ChristianaCare Newark Campus
  • ChristianaCare Wilmington Campus
  • Middletown Emergency Department

Christiana Care Newark Campus is the only Level 1 Adult Trauma Center between Philadelphia and Baltimore. ChristianaCare Wilmington Campus is a Level 3 Adult Trauma Center. Middletown Emergency Department is a freestanding ED. Our Emergency Departments see approximately 195000 patients annually servicing an average of 500 patients per day in combined visits from all 3 departments. There are 162 patient rooms including state-of-the-art trauma resuscitation facilities between the 3 departments.
